
Set Iron
Set Iron is a term used in maritime context to refer to the process of aligning the compass of a ship with the magnetic north. This is done by adjusting the iron masses on board the ship to counteract the deviation caused by the ship's own magnetic field. The process of Set Iron involves taking readings from the ship's compass and comparing them with the readings from a known magnetic source. The difference between the two readings is then used to calculate the deviation and the necessary adjustments are made to the iron masses. Set Iron is a crucial process for ensuring the accuracy of a ship's navigation and preventing navigational errors that could lead to accidents or getting lost at sea.
